			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>There was a piece on the radio show &#8220;<a href="http://theworld.org/">The World</a>&#8221; today about Sitara Achakzai, a woman born in Kandahar and relocated to Canada, a refugee of the Soviet war. During her early years, she grew up in a very different Afghanistan, one more like the first few chapters of <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Kite-Runner-Khaled-Hosseini/dp/1594480001">The Kite Runner</a> than the war-torn poppy producer of today&#8217;s headlines. She was encouraged to go to school and to walk into town without a viel by her father who taught her that &#8220;Rights are not given &#8211; they must be taken.&#8221; That seems universally and historically true &#8211; in our country we have honored that truth with a revolution, a bill of rights, myriad amendments to the law of our land, treaties and movements that have culminated in new laws.</p>

<p>Sitara continued to fight for the rights of Afghan women, moving back to Afghanistan in 2004 to become a provincial councillor. She spoke up for women and spoke out against such laws as <a href="http://www.theglobeandmail.com/servlet/story/RTGAM.20090413.wafghanfamily0414/BNStory/International">the legalization of rape within marriage</a>.</p>
